[pg 60.]
New York May 3d 1799
Sir,
The Secretary of War has transmitted me your letter of 23d April. The practice of drawing rations for the Sons of Soldiers cannot be [strikethrough: allowed] sanctioned —
permitted to be —
[signed] Lt. M [undecipherable: Pike?]
